Smokey John's has been serving barbecue in Dallas, Texas, since 1976, but it was losing money. Then, a devastating fire destroyed the entire restaurant in 2017. So, brothers Brent and Juan Reaves had to rebuild it from scratch. Their bet paid off. Today, Smokey John's makes nearly $4 million in annual revenue and goes through roughly 2,000 pounds of brisket each week.
